a walk on a rectangular grid

 PIXIE takes a walk on a rectangular grid of n rows and 3 columns, starting from the bottom left corner.
At each step, he can either move one square to the right or simultaneously move one square to the left
and one square up. In how many ways can he reach the center square of the topmost row?
